Evaluation value of combined monitoring of bispectral index and neuron-specific enolase in the prognosis of patients with traumatic brain injury |

Abstract Objective To explore the diagnostic value of combined monitoring of bispectral index (BIS) and neuron-specific enolase (NSE) in the prognosis of patients with traumatic brain injury. Methods A total of 60 patients with raumatic brain injury from March 2020 to July 2021 in Wujin Hospital Affiliated to Jiangsu University were selected as the research subjects. According to the Glasgow outcome scale (GOS), they were divided into the good prognosis group (n=23) and the poor prognosis group (n=37). All patients received BIS monitoring and NSE level detection. The BIS value and NSE level of the two groups of patients were compared, and the correlation between BIS value and NSE index and prognostic score, as well as the predictive value of BIS value and NSE index on the prognosis of traumatic brain injury were analyzed. Results The BIS level in the good prognosis group was higher than that in the poor prognosis group, while the NSE level in the good prognosis group was lower than that in the poor prognosis group, and the differences were statistically significant (P<0.05). The results of correlation analysis showed that the BIS value was positively correlated with the prognostic GOS score (r=0.712, P=0.001), and the NSE level was negatively correlated with the prognostic GOS score (r=-0.606, P=0.001). Combined monitoring of BIS value and NSE index (AUC=0.93) had higher sensitivity and specificity than those of single BIS value (AUC=0.81) and NSE index (AUC=0.77) in predicting poor prognosis of traumatic brain injury. Conclusion Both BIS value and serum NSE level can reflect the prognosis quality of patients with traumatic brain injury. The lower the BIS value, the higher the NSE index, the worse the prognosis quality, and the combined monitoring is more conducive to improving the monitoring sensitivity and specificity, which is worthy of clinical promotion.
